Each time a daily build comes out I end up testing the same scene (attached) to see how things are coming along with instancing lights. But the results have always been the same.
If you look at the attached scene, just select the 3 cloners and change the instance modes.
Then compare the IR and VFB/PV.

I know there is a lot of talk about Scatter and multi instancing but I am really finding it hard to work with a lack of render instances when it comes to lights. Of course multi instance support would been even more appreciated!
I use hundreds of lights in the type of work I do and I have two options at present...

1) Set all cloned lights to Instance mode and then have to deal with the usual speed issues associated with that.
2) Set all cloned lights to Render Instances modes and work with IR ok but have to change all cloned lights back to Instance mode at render time as render instances do not work in VFB/PV.

I am sure you can appreciate both options above are not ideal.

Another issue is with lights that are set to "Visible" seem to ignore the light select in multi pass. Take a look at the front lights in the light mix in the attached scene. This then means I have to ditch cloners altogether and have individual lights just so I can use light mix.
The light beams are correctly assigned but the visible "source" gets assigned to "rest unassigned" but that becomes an issue when I have lots of different visible lights all assigned to "rest".

I am using the Scaffolding rig from the Pixel lab and decided to make the materials Corona based. All went well until I noticed that rendering in the IR made some objects that were hidden suddenly appear.
There is a lot of instancing going on with this rig and I checked through and could not find any errors with visibility settings (traffic lights).

If you look at the screen shots you will see everything appears as it should in the viewport but the IR shows extra objects that should be hidden.
I have also included an image rendered to the PV and this is OK and shows what is in the VP. Rendering to the VFB also gives the correct result.

I am thinking this could be related to "render instances" but my past experience of this has been that render instance objects do not appear at all and they have not ignored the traffic light settings.

Any thoughts?

Using Corona 4 hotfix1
OSX-10.14.5
C4D R20
